Summary
Space Safety and Situational Awareness Transition Act of 2022 or the Space SSA Transition Act of 2022 This bill sets out a process to transition responsibilities for space situational awareness capabilities (i.e., the knowledge and characterization of space objects and their operational environment to facilitate decisions that support safe, stable, and sustainable space activities) from the Department of Defense to the Department of Commerce by December 31, 2025. The bill requires the National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A) to establish research and development programs related to space situational awareness.
